I love the unusual structure and symmetry of this delicate galaxy!!! NGC 1398 is a barred spiral galaxy in 65 million light years away in Fornax, it has a prominent double ring structure.
The spiral arms do not begin in the middle of the galaxy but rather emanate from a straight bar which passes through the galaxy center.
Dust lanes in the central portion of the galaxy are clearly visible.
Imaged in LRGB on the RiDK 700 at Observatorio El Sauce, Chile
